Joint Perspective on Opportunities and Challenges between Animal Welfare and Breeding
The objective of this project is to facilitate a discussion on perspectives of animal welfare in animal breeding from the viewpoints of welfare scientists, geneticists/animal breeders, and key stakeholders in the livestock industries. The relationship between animal welfare and animal breeding is often positioned as adversarial and sometimes it can be challenging to collaborate. We want to better understand why these challenges might occur, and provide a roadmap for how to pursue animal welfare in genetics and breeding research in a way that promotes animal welfare from the perspective of welfare scientists, and is feasible from a geneticist perspective. This project involves a strategic series of workshops to facilitate constructive discourse on this topic and will ultimately result in a roadmap for improved collaboration between all stakeholders with regards to animal welfare in animal breeding.
This workshop will combine the outputs from previous project workshops with animal welfare scientists and animal geneticists to offer a facilitated discussion of the similarities and differences between visions, values, and definitions with regards to animal welfare in animal breeding. The main objective of this workshop will be to overcome any differences in vision to develop a roadmap or suggestion for animal welfare in animal breeding. We expect these workshops to be a stimulating and relevant discussion of challenges and opportunities in these key animal research sectors, as well as an excellent opportunity to network with colleagues within and across disciplines.
